From b3a74660ffd03e743fce5690fb432f141b69b9f7 Mon Sep 17 00:00:00 2001 From: Bhupendra Bhusman Bhardwaj Date: Wed, 11 Apr 2007 16:07:58 +0000 Subject: synchronized with hash mechanism used in Broker git-svn-id: https://svn.apache.org/repos/asf/incubator/qpid/branches/M2@527556 13f79535-47bb-0310-9956-ffa450edef68 --- .../management/ui/sasl/UsernameHashedPasswordCallbackHandler.java | 8 +++----- 1 file changed, 3 insertions(+), 5 deletions(-) (limited to 'java/management') diff --git a/java/management/eclipse-plugin/src/main/java/org/apache/qpid/management/ui/sasl/UsernameHashedPasswordCallbackHandler.java b/java/management/eclipse-plugin/src/main/java/org/apache/qpid/management/ui/sasl/UsernameHashedPasswordCallbackHandler.java index 12090e866a..43f7af52f0 100644 --- a/java/management/eclipse-plugin/src/main/java/org/apache/qpid/management/ui/sasl/UsernameHashedPasswordCallbackHandler.java +++ b/java/management/eclipse-plugin/src/main/java/org/apache/qpid/management/ui/sasl/UsernameHashedPasswordCallbackHandler.java @@ -65,7 +65,6 @@ public class UsernameHashedPasswordCallbackHandler implements CallbackHandler private char[] getHash(String text) throws NoSuchAlgorithmException, UnsupportedEncodingException { - byte[] data = text.getBytes("utf-8"); MessageDigest md = MessageDigest.getInstance("MD5"); @@ -77,13 +76,12 @@ public class UsernameHashedPasswordCallbackHandler implements CallbackHandler byte[] digest = md.digest(); - char[] hash = new char[digest.length + 1]; + char[] hash = new char[digest.length ]; int index = 0; for (byte b : digest) - { - index++; - hash[index] = (char) b; + { + hash[index++] = (char) b; } return hash; -- cgit v1.2.1